In Part 2 of this fabulous two-part episode, host Ann Roushar continues her heartwarming and hilarious conversation with Alldan Langston, better known as Lexi Belle. This time, we go deeper into Lexi’s behind-the-scenes routines, her life in and out of drag, and how she brings joy to every corner of the Cedar Rapids community.
You’ll laugh, you’ll learn, and you’ll fall even more in love with Lexi as she shares drag secrets, local good news, and her plans for Pride and beyond. From setting spray to Sharpie lip liner, nothing is off-limits in this candid and colorful conversation.
